My family also uses the PSN and the EyeToy for video conferences. Very cool application! 
My three-year-old niece loves seeing her grandparents on the TV talking to her.
Other uses for the EyeToy:
SingStar uses it very well. Records clips of you singing the songs and you can then add effects and stuff.
LittleBigPlanet looks to be the most useful application other than the ones that NEED the EyeToy though.
